D'Aloia, Donna ALBANY Donna D'Aloia, age 68, passed away peacefully at home surrounded by her loving family on February 1, 2019. Donna was born and raised in Mechanicville, the daughter of Michael A. D'Aloia of Mechanicville and the late Mildred (O'Brien) D'Aloia. She is survived by her son Kevin...
